When You Dye Your Eyebrows Too Dark. Unfortunately, this can't always be fixed immediately. It’s not unheard of to remove bad eyebrow tint or brow dye—but don’t be alarmed by first impressions. The number one rule for a botched eyebrow tint is to not stress about the immediate colour. Eyebrow dye always fades within the first week due to the skin’s natural oils and regular showering. The shade may be too dark, too light, or there may be excess dye. Sometimes, your eyebrows may look too dark because the dye has soaked into your skin, instead of just your eyebrow hairs. If your brows end up looking too dark, it's probably because some tint got deposited onto the skin underneath the hairs. You can always go darker if you find your brows aren't dark enough, but choosing a shade lighter than your hair color will prevent you from dyeing them too dark, too quickly.
